Full job description

Job Summary

We are seeking a dedicated and experienced EHS (Environmental, Health, and Safety) Leader to oversee and enhance our safety programs within our manufacturing facility. The ideal candidate will lead initiatives to ensure compliance with safety regulations, promote a culture of safety awareness, and support continuous improvement in environmental and health standards. This role offers an opportunity to influence safety practices directly impacting employee well-being and operational excellence.

Responsibilities:

SPECIFIC D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Environmental, Health & Safety:

· Through the auditing program, ensure employee compliance to the company’s safety and environmental systems.

· EH&S incident investigation and reporting.

· Leads site EH&S training.

· Monitors, maintains, and develops Company Safety programs.

· Primary contact with Toronto Water and MECP on environmental regulatory issues.

· Primary contact for community concerns.

· Maintains & develops the internal EH&S auditing program.

· Main contact for Fire Department, owns fire protection plan.

· Co-ordinates employee safety & JHSC meetings. Maintains and summarizes key KPIs related to environmental issues.

· Monitors, maintains, and develops Company Environmental programs.

· Manages effluent treatment system with a “Hands-On Approach”.

· Manages hazardous waste, waste and recycling disposal contractors.

· Waste water spill reporting.

· CHEMTRAX reporting.

· NPRI reporting.

· EASR Reporting.

· Stays up-to-date on all Federal, Provincial and Municipal reporting requirements.

· Other duties as assigned.

TRAINING AND SPECIALIZED KNOWLEDGE REQUIRED

· Minimum 5 years’ experience with Safety Standards (OHSA), WHMIS.

· Experience with Municipal, Provincial, and Federal environmental regulation.

VIII. EXPERIENCE REQUIRED

Minimum 5 years’ experience with Environmental and Safety Standards in a manufacturing environment. 4-year degree or higher will be considered in lieu of experience.

Strong knowledge of federal, provincial, and municipal safety and environmental regulations. Strong knowledge of municipal sewer by-laws preferred but not necessary.

Experience conducting safety audits and inspections and developing and implementing corrective action plans.

Strong training and communication skills, and experience developing and delivering safety training programs.

Experience investigating incidents and accidents and developing and implementing preventive measures. MS Office Intermediate level is mandatory. Advanced level is an asset.
